@@ -205,7 +205,7 @@ This function has two bodies with `;` in between. Each one has a *header*, separ
The first header, `· 𝕊 ' ':`, is more specific. The function is unlabelled, since `𝕊` just indicates the block function it's in (useful for [recursion](block.md#self-reference)). The right argument is `' '`, a space character, so this body will only be used if `𝕩` is a space. And the left argument is… `·`, which is called [Nothing](expression.md#nothing). Both here and as an assignment target, Nothing indicates an ignored value. This body *does* require a left argument, but it doesn't name it. And the body itself is just `spl⇐1`. The `⇐` makes this body (only this one!) return a namespace, which has only the field `spl`.

Going left to right, `GV‿GS` indicates [destructuring assignment](expression.md#destructuring), which will expect a list of two values on the right and take it apart to assign the two names. The right hand side is the function `{𝕏¨}¨` applied to a list.
